What Each Certificate of Analysis Includes
Each Certificate of Analysis documents the following analytical results:
Identity Testing
HPLC/MS verification of molecular structure
Purity Analysis
Quantitative purity determination by HPLC
Peptide Content
Net peptide content measurement
Appearance
Visual inspection and color verification
Solubility
Dissolution testing in specified solvents
Endotoxin Testing
LAL testing for bacterial endotoxins
Sterility
Microbial contamination screening
Heavy Metals
ICP-MS testing for metal contaminants
